Periodontist and implantologist specializing in bone augmentation, soft tissue management, and advanced implant surgery. Periodontist at Vilnius Implantology Center (VIC Clinic), one of Lithuania's most advanced dental facilities.

 

Over 20 years of clinical experience focusing on guided bone regeneration, ridge splitting techniques, sinus augmentation, and decompression technique for lateral bone augmentation in posterior mandible. Developed innovative protocols for bone augmentation achieving predictable long-term results. Active researcher in periodontal and implant therapy with focus on cement excess detection, peri-implant tissue management, and biological complications prevention.

 

International lecturer and course instructor delivering practical hands-on training programs at national and international levels. Fellow of the International Team for Implantology (ITI), partner since 2010 and full member since 2017. Recipient of ITI Poster Presentation Prize at 2010 ITI Congress in Geneva for research on "The influence of margin location on the amount of undetected cement excess after delivery of cement-retained implant restorations."

 

DDS. Specialist in Periodontology. PhD. Fellow of Lithuanian Association of Periodontology. Member of the Baltic Osseointegration Association. Completed Certificate Program for the European Association for Osseointegration (EAO) in 2014. Published extensively in international peer-reviewed journals on implant dentistry, peri-implant disease, and bone augmentation techniques.

 

Orthodontist specializing in temporary anchorage devices and biomechanics. Founder of Beethoven Orthodontic Center and Newton's A Inc. in Hsinchu, Taiwan. Inventor of OrthoBoneScrews (OBS), a skeletal anchorage system widely used in contemporary orthodontics.

 

Over 30 years of clinical experience utilizing miniscrews and bone plates for maximum anchorage in complex orthodontic cases. Pioneer in developing simplified bone screw placement techniques achieving high success rates and minimal patient discomfort. Developer of non-surgical treatment protocols for severe malocclusions traditionally requiring orthognathic surgery, using strategic OBS placement for three-dimensional tooth movement control.

 

International lecturer and educator teaching OBS techniques through workshops and clinical demonstrations worldwide. Publisher of the International Journal of Orthodontics (JDO), distributed internationally. Conducts multi-day intensive training programs at Beethoven clinic allowing participants to observe live OBS placements and clinical workflows. Known for exceptional patient volume management, treating hundreds of active cases simultaneously with high efficiency and quality outcomes.

 

DDS. PhD in Bone Physiology from Indiana University, USA. Certificate in Orthodontics from Indiana University. Diplomate of the American Board of Orthodontics (ABO). Active member of the Angle Society-Midwest. Author and co-author of multiple orthodontic textbooks including "Orthodontics" Volumes 1-6, "Words of Wisdom," "Jobsology," and "Trumpology." Developer of clinical protocols for OBS placement integrating anatomy, physiology, and biomechanics for predictable skeletal anchorage. Lectures internationally on temporary anchorage devices, biomechanics, and efficient practice management in orthodontics.

He has been a full time faculty member at the University of Kentucky for 45 years. He is recognized worldwide as an authority in the field of TMD and orofacial pain, lecturing in every state in the USA and 59 different foreign countries. His textbooks have been translated into eleven different foreign languages and have become a standard for teaching throughout the world. His peers have called him the “World Ambassador for Orofacial pain”. He is a highly sought after speaker and has given more than 1300 invited lectures throughout the world. He has received numerous awards, honors and recognitions for his outstanding teaching and educational abilities. Some of these awards include the campus wide University of Kentucky “Great Teacher Award”, the Provost’s Distinguished Service Professorship, the American Academy of Orofacial Pain’s Service Award and the first ever “Distinguished Alumni Award” from the College of Dentistry. In addition, he received the State of Kentucky Acorn Award for the best professor in the state and was inducted into the University of Kentucky Hall of Distinguished Alumni. Dr. Okeson has also received “The International Dentist of the Year Award” from the Academy of Dentistry International. This is the highest award recognized by this Academy and was given to him in recognition of his worldwide efforts in providing education in the area of temporomandibular disorders and orofacial pain. In addition to his two textbooks, he has more then 240 publications in scientific journals. He is founder of the Orofacial Pain Program at the University of Kentucky. He has developed several full-time teaching programs associated with the Center. The Master of Science Degree program he established was the first in the United States to be accredited by the American Academy of Orofacial Pain. The Orofacial Pain Residency Program was one of the very first to be accreditated by the Commission on Dental Accreditation. This program has graduated 65 full time residents from 26 different countries. He is active in many national and international organizations and is past president of the American Academy of Orofacial Pain. He is also a founding diplomate and twice past president of the American Board of Orofacial Pain. Dr. Okeson is presently serving as Dean of the University of Kentucky College of Dentistry.
